Players from both FC Team sides and Redbridge Jewish Care took centre stage on Matchday 4 of the MGBSFL.
1. BEN SHELDON (NL Raiders C) - "stepped in to play in net with a bunch of players he's not played with before. Was extremely commanding and made excellent saves including a stunning penalty save"
2. JONNY KAYE (AC MILL HILL) - didn't put a foot wrong against Jewdinese
3. IAN BARON (L'Equipe) - "immense" in the goalless draw against Raiders C
4. BRANDON SASSOON (Jewdinese) - "defended well but in attack he played like an experienced striker. Scored three goals to make the score line respectable "
5. YONNI BORD (Catford & Bromley Maccabi) - "his last game before departing for Israel. He was exceptional in the middle of the park - scoring one and laying another on for Joel Isaacs with an exceptional through ball. He was often the last line of defence and then the furthest man forward. Possibly his best game in a Catford shirt (and there've been a fair few good performances from him over the years for the Cats)"
6. BEN RADSTONE (FC Team C) - "stopped a lot of the Whestone attacks, worked hard and was a massive presence in the centre of midfield"
7. EMILE BEN ATAR (FC Team C) - "centre midfielder played at centre back and won everything in the air and was composed on the ball"
8. BLAKE BUCKMAN (FC Team C) - "scored the opening goal and caused the Whetstone defence problems with his running and direct play. Worked hard defensively and put in a lot of strong challenges"
9. LORIAN MADANES (FC Team B) - "captain for the game and dictated the play for 90 minutes"
10. BEN ZLOOF (AC Mill Hill) - two-goal hero was man-of-the-match in the 4-3 thriller against 'Nese
11. MITCH YOUNG (FC Team B) "first start of the season and was not meant to play after just having a baby, but the side needed him as only had 10 players - solid"
